Here's how it works: Your camera attempts to determine the color temperature of the scene by balancing the amount of red, green, and blue light detected in the scene.
 
Pre-set white balance settings allow for your input. In a room lit wholly by flourescent light, choose the flourescent white balance setting.
 
The problem is that every scene is different, and for indoor photography, more often than not, the lighting in the room is from a variety of sources, directions, and intensities. These mixed lighting situations are where custom white balance settings can save your images and save you hours of editing.

Many professional and andvanced amateurs alike take color correction into their own hands by using a software solution like Adobe Lightroom, Nikon Capture, or Canon Digital Photo Pro. There is yet a better way to get accurate color without post capture processing, and all of the digital SLR's on the market have this ability. It is called custom white balance.
 
To make custom white balance work all you need is a calibration device. These devices range from just over $5.00 to right around $150.00. No matter what device you choose, the critical element is a calibrated middle grey image. Our favorite device is the Expodisc ($69.99 - $149.99) from Expoimaging; because, it works in all lighting scenarios, no matter how many light sources, flashes, reflectors, etc. The most inexpensive option is the good old fashioned grey card, which also provides accurate exposure information, and is equally adept at determining white balance for ambient light (no flash).
